A few words about our Division
The Powder Solutions division is a world-leading provider of tungsten products used in the manufacturing of high-tech tools and metal powder for manufacturing technologies such as Metal Injection Molding and 3D printing. We serve a wide customer base spanning industries including automotive, aerospace, energy, infrastructure, electronics, and mining. With unique expertise and extensive experience, coupled with a strong focus on sustainability, we’re well-equipped to further strengthen our current position and foster the growth of our business.
